Address 0 PPC

PLyPPGyVybsRuyJ7NViQmJNF4FUNqzdxrH

Confirmed

Total Received10.905888 PPC
Total Sent10.905888 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PLyPPGyVybsRuyJ7NViQmJNF4FUNqzdxrH10.905888 PPC
Fee: 0.01 PPC
718448 Confirmations10.895888 PPC
Fee: 0.01 PPC
718537 Confirmations291.905888 PPC